Numerous frantic businesses are putting together inferior products they claim are really T1 solutions. Be wary of products with the funny titles such as "burstable" as well as "reach". These items can be oversubscribed similar to a DSL product. This suggests the provider puts a single T1 link within a CO (Central Office) and gives T1 hook ups to 3 or four clients hoping individuals usually do not all make use of the resource at the same time. T1 access implies sole usage of the Internet and you invariably have access to 1.54Mbps.
Make certain the T1 service for Layton is really a "clearchannel" item and isn't shared with different clients. Also be certain you truly have a powerful SLA or Service Level Agreement from your provider. A SLA will define the access you can receive and the penalty the service supplier will pay in the event that they do not provide such service.
